Arepitas de yuca

Delicious yuca fritters, crunchy traditional treats in Dominican cuisine. The sweetness of anise combines with the yuca dough, creating a perfect bite for lovers of Latin flavors. An easy preparation with simple ingredients. Enjoy!

The preparation of yuca arepitas requires finely grating the tuber and mixing it with sugar, salt, egg, and anise seeds.

The mixture should be homogeneous before frying in hot oil until golden.

After removing them from the heat, it is recommended to place them on absorbent paper to remove excess grease and serve with salsa.

Ingredients

500 grams of Yuca, peeled and washed

1 Beaten egg

1 teaspoon of Anise seeds

1 teaspoon of Sugar

300 milliliters of Vegetable oil for frying

1 teaspoon of Salt

Preparation

Step 1 : The recipe starts by finely grating the yuca and then placing it in a bowl along with the sugar, salt, egg, and anise seeds.

Step 2 : It's important to mix the ingredients very well until a homogeneous dough is obtained.

Step 3 : Heat the oil in a pan and pour a portion of the mixture, frying until golden on both sides.

Step 4 : Remove the arepitas from the pan and place them on paper towels to absorb excess oil.

Step 5 : Finally, serve them accompanied by your preferred salsa.
